Course Content

• Understanding Retaliation: Definitions, Legal Frameworks, and Protected Activities
• Identifying Retaliatory Actions: Subtleties, Patterns, and Common Tactics
• Investigating Retaliation Claims: Best Practices and Evidence Gathering
• Addressing Retaliation: Effective Interventions and Remedial Actions
• Documentation and Record Keeping in Retaliation Cases
• Preventing Retaliation: Proactive Measures and Workplace Culture
• Retaliation and Discrimination: Overlapping Issues and Legal Considerations
• Responding to Retaliation Complaints: Ethical Considerations and Due Process

Career path

Role Description
HR Manager (Retaliation Specialist) Investigates and resolves retaliation claims, ensuring compliance with UK employment law. Develops and delivers anti-retaliation training programs. High demand.
Employment Lawyer (Retaliation Expert) Provides legal counsel on retaliation cases, representing employees or employers in tribunals. Deep understanding of UK employment law and case precedents.
Compliance Officer (Whistleblowing & Retaliation) Monitors compliance with whistleblowing legislation and investigates potential retaliation incidents. Develops and implements company policies.
Industrial Relations Specialist (Retaliation Prevention) Proactively addresses potential conflicts and prevents retaliation. Advises management on best practices and conflict resolution.
